Compare commits
No commits in common. "63567a4d7bc131c8641532c076c1f04c2d22c420" and "a36710cb4c464edfac75819ce7061076a22b9da4" have entirely different histories.
63567a4d7b
...
a36710cb4c
|
@ -4,12 +4,11 @@ Simple CSS framework.
|
||||||
|
|
||||||
**Heavily** inspired by [GitHub - CodyHouse/codyhouse-framework](https://github.com/CodyHouse/codyhouse-framework).
|
**Heavily** inspired by [GitHub - CodyHouse/codyhouse-framework](https://github.com/CodyHouse/codyhouse-framework).
|
||||||
|
|
||||||
## TODO
|
**NOTE** media queries based on variables have only been implemented for SASS. No postccss solution has yet been implemented.
|
||||||
|
|
||||||
* css - minified for production (cssnano should be doing this)
|
## TODO
|
||||||
* Images and SVGs
|
|
||||||
* sass loader - ensure mixins don't conflict with postcss mixins
|
|
||||||
|
|
||||||
* documentation
|
* documentation
|
||||||
- .text-component
|
- .text-component
|
||||||
- visibility.css - make notes on classes with `\:` in the selectors
|
- visibility.css - make notes on classes with `\:` in the selectors
|
||||||
|
- media queries (sass codyhouse implementation)
|
||||||
|
|
|
@ -6,7 +6,7 @@ const postcssMixins = {
|
||||||
// TODO - untest
|
// TODO - untest
|
||||||
defineHSL(mixin, name, hue, sat, light) {
|
defineHSL(mixin, name, hue, sat, light) {
|
||||||
const obj = {};
|
const obj = {};
|
||||||
obj[name] = `hsl(${hue}, ${sat}, ${light})`;
|
obj[name] = name;
|
||||||
// need to ensure hue is a string otherwise postcss (is it postcss?) appends
|
// need to ensure hue is a string otherwise postcss (is it postcss?) appends
|
||||||
// 'px' to the property's value.
|
// 'px' to the property's value.
|
||||||
obj[`${name}__h`] = hue.toString();
|
obj[`${name}__h`] = hue.toString();
|
||||||
|
|
Loading…
Reference in New Issue